We left and noticed what turned out to be a charming
Latin American restaurant around the corner.
The chef/owner/waitress also turned out to be charming and
lots of fun….
But it was nearly empty.
Well, rather than walking and walking we said
ok……..
They
had sangria, beer and empanadas...
Not a bad start
It is located at
173 Orchard Street
Between Houston and Stanton

I ordered the empanada sampler....
One each of....
Pulled pork + caramelized onion
Chorizo + aged Manchego
Queso blanco
Herb chicken + olive
Spiced beef + tomato
Portobello + smoked Gouda
with
Chipotle mayonnaise
I liked the pork and the chorizo best....
